How much do agtek j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for agtek in the United States is $73,275.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,000.00 and $86,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working as an Agtek Earthwork Takeoff Technician?

As an Agtek Earthwork Takeoff Technician, your daily responsibilities generally include analyzing digital construction plans, preparing accurate earthwork volume estimates using Agtek software, and generating reports for project managers and estimators. You will frequently coordinate with surveyors, engineers, and project leads to clarify requirements, resolve discrepancies, and ensure that all calculations align with project specifications. Attention to detail is key, as even minor errors can impact project budgets and timelines. The role often involves a mix of independent work, software-based analysis, and teamwork within a collaborative construction office environ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Agtek position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Agtek (Earthwork Takeoff Technician), a solid background in civil engineering, construction management, or surveying, along with strong mathematical and analytical skills, is essential. Familiarity with Agtek software, CAD programs, and digital plan reading are key technical requirements, and industry certifications such as OSHA safety training can be beneficial.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help ensure precise project estimates and smooth collaboration with project teams. These skills enable accurate earthwork calculations, support project planning, and contribute to overall efficiency and cost management in construction projects.

What is an Agtek job?

An Agtek job typically involves using Agtek software for earthwork takeoffs, quantity estimation, and site modeling in construction and civil engineering projects. Professionals in this role use Agtek tools to analyze topographic data, calculate materials needed, and optimize project planning. These roles are common in excavation, grading, and site development, where accurate earthwork calculations are essential. Strong skills in CAD, GIS, and construction estimating are often required.

Job description

Summary:

The ideal candidate will have significant estimating and quantity take-off experience for site work, paving, concrete, and underground utilities related to institutional, commercial, and industrial construction projects. Prior experience with civil construction subcontractors, significant individual-performance, and AGTEK estimating software proficiency is strongly preferred.


Essential Responsibilities:

  • Understand and Analyze detailed bid specifications, schematics, and drawings
  • Prepare accurate estimates/packages for projects
  • Assist Operations with scheduling, job layout, and change order preparation
  • Track progress of multiple bids and bid results
  • Oversee and manage change orders during project progression
  • Oversee and manage project closeouts at completion
  • Deliver accurate and timely estimates/bid proposals to clients
  • Maintain positive relations with clients, subcontractors, and vendors
  • Communicate effectively with other departments and team members
  • Some local travel to review bids and inspect current conditions at job sites


Requirements:

  • Five to seven years' experience in construction within an individual-performance environment
  • Some college-level construction management study preferred
  • Proficient knowledge of earthwork, underground utilities, concrete, and asphalt
  • Experience with estimating and design software (B2W, AGTEK, AutoCad, PlanSwift)
  • General knowledge of construction equipment applications
  • Create and maintain relationships with colleagues, clients, subcontractors, and vendors
  • Must possess strong verbal,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ills
  • Work with peers in a team environment
  • Demonstrated knowledge of geotechnical skills
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ills
  • Proficient with Microsoft Excel and strong computer skills
  • Bilingual in Spanish and English is a plus
  • Valid Driver's License
